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Direct Message UX #192

Closed
ivanminutillo opened this issue Mar 4, 2022 · 1 comment
Closed

Direct Message UX #192

ivanminutillo opened this issue Mar 4, 2022 · 1 comment

Comments

@ivanminutillo
Copy link
Contributor

ivanminutillo commented Mar 4, 2022

Here some thoughts about a Direct Message UI / UX for our beta release...
It contains several differences with how DM works now. Here the main points:

  • Single thread: ATM each DM is a separate thread, in this UX we have just 1 thread for each conversation with a selected user/s (we may want to add more flexibility later, adding the possibility to create a new thread if same users want to discuss about a specific topic)
  • Flat Thread UI: Users can reply to specific messages, like telegram / matrix but messages will be shown in chronological orders with reference to replied messages (Nested thread for DM can be odd when dealing with a more sync conversation)

Desktop - 8 (3)

@ivanminutillo ivanminutillo added New Issue Please apply this label to any new issues :) UI/UX labels Mar 4, 2022
@ivanminutillo ivanminutillo added this to the Bonfire Social - beta milestone Mar 4, 2022
@ivanminutillo ivanminutillo added Discussion and removed New Issue Please apply this label to any new issues :) labels Mar 4, 2022
@ivanminutillo
Copy link
Contributor Author

An interesting variation for DM could be moving the composer at the bottom of the DM section, so from one side we could have the left sidebar fully taken by the list of messages, and the main section that behave more like a private chats (with the composer component sticked at the bottom of the screen)

DM FLOW

ivanminutillo added a commit to bonfire-networks/bonfire_ui_social that referenced this issue Apr 20, 2022
mayel added a commit to bonfire-networks/bonfire_me that referenced this issue Apr 21, 2022
mayel added a commit to bonfire-networks/bonfire_social that referenced this issue Apr 21, 2022
mayel added a commit to bonfire-networks/bonfire_ui_social that referenced this issue Apr 21, 2022
ivanminutillo added a commit to bonfire-networks/bonfire_ui_social that referenced this issue Apr 21, 2022
ivanminutillo added a commit to bonfire-networks/bonfire_ui_social that referenced this issue Apr 21, 2022
mayel added a commit to bonfire-networks/bonfire_ui_social that referenced this issue Apr 22, 2022
ivanminutillo pushed a commit to bonfire-networks/bonfire_editor_ck that referenced this issue Apr 23, 2022
ivanminutillo pushed a commit to bonfire-networks/bonfire_ui_social that referenced this issue Apr 23, 2022
ivanminutillo pushed a commit to bonfire-networks/bonfire_ui_social that referenced this issue Apr 23, 2022
ivanminutillo pushed a commit to bonfire-networks/bonfire_ui_social that referenced this issue Apr 24, 2022
@mayel mayel closed this as completed Apr 27,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ants